Can You Machine Wash Viscose. But it should be done using a gentle cycle with mild detergent cool or lukewarm water. Learn how to wash and remove stains from this type of clothing. We also don’t recommend tumble drying viscose pieces, as the heat can cause shrinkage and damage. Once the fabric is completely dry, you can lightly steam it using a handheld steamer on the lowest heat setting.
